天天看點

jupyter notebook 打開md檔案後沒有運作按鈕

jupyter notebook 打開md檔案後沒有運作按鈕

jupyter notebook是一個比較比較不錯的網頁版python編輯器,但是,由于很多“技術文檔”都是直接以markdown(.md格式的檔案)的格式編寫的,而且jupyter notebook的代碼檔案(.ipynb)也可以轉換成.md格式的檔案,更為重要的是,我們從github上下載下傳的很多學習資料也都是.md檔案格式的。是以,為了能夠在jupyter notebook上實作:

  1. 使用jupyter notebook浏覽技術文檔;
  2. 将轉換成.md格式的python代碼在不用轉換格式的情況下直接由jupyter notebook上打開并且運作代碼;
  3. 更加友善的由jupyter notebook看github下載下傳的資料。

我們需要在jupyter notebook中加入能夠閱讀.md檔案的功能。

如果你的notebook打開md檔案後,隻能閱讀找不到run按鈕,執行以下幾步就可以了:

  1. 在Anaconda Prompt 中 運作conda list 指令,看你有沒有

    notedown插件(它是用來渲染md檔案的,有了它之後jupyter notebook打開md後才能運作其中的代碼)。如果沒有,pip

    install notedown

  2. 生成jupyter配置檔案(如果已經生成過可以跳過) jupyter notebook --generate-config
  3. 将下面這一行加入到生成的配置檔案的末尾(Linux/macOS一般在~/.jupyter/jupyter_notebook_config.py)

    c.NotebookApp.contents_manager_class=

    ‘notedown.NotedownContentsManager’

然後打開jupyter notebook 就可以正常使用了

參考:

1.https://www.cnblogs.com/damin1909/p/12526981.html

2.https://www.cnblogs.com/ya-cpp/p/9084527.html